This burp extension helps to find host header injection vulnerabilities by actively testing a set of injection types. A scan issue is created if an injection was successful.
Features
- Active Scanner
- Manually select a request to check multiple types of host header injections.
- Collaborator payload: Inject a collaborator string to check for server-side request forgery.
- Localhost payload: Inject the string "localhost" to check for restricted feature bypass.
- Canary payload (only manual): Inject a canary to check for host header reflection which can lead to cache poisoning.
Usage
Run an active scan or manually select a request to check:
- Go to the HTTP History.
- Right-click on the request you want to check.
- Extension -> Host Header Inchecktion -> payload type
- In case of a successful injection a scan issue is generated
